Columbus School Leaders Earn Top Salaries | Columbus News

Columbus City Schools’ top earners revealed: Superintendent Angela Chapman took home $285,121 last year, followed closely by former chief of staff Michael De Fabbo at $215,051. Payroll records uncovered through a public request show the district’s top five earners also include the COO, CFO, and deputy superintendent—all key decision-makers. Total pay includes bonuses, holidays, and stipends, making compensation more complex than base salary.
